What the numbers show
Total net attendance rate, primary, urban, middle quintile, both sexes (%) is currently reported for 27 countries. The highest value is 100.0% in Panama; the lowest is 65.5% in Mali.
The median across all reporting countries is 98.5%, and the mean is 93.7%.
The gap between the highest and lowest reporting country is a factor of about 2.
Over the past decade 15 countries rose and 12 fell. The largest increase was in Mali (up 16.7%), and the largest decrease in Bangladesh (down 6.3%).
Total net attendance rate, primary, urban, middle quintile, both sexes: full country ranking
| # | Country | Latest | Year | 10-year change | Trend |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Panama | 100.0% | 2023 | up 0.5% | flat |
| 2 | Paraguay | 99.9% | 2024 | down 0.1% | flat |
| 3 | Argentina | 99.8% | 2023 | up 1.0% | flat |
| 3 | Uruguay | 99.8% | 2023 | up 0.9% | flat |
| 5 | Brazil | 99.5% | 2023 | up 0.2% | flat |
| 6 | Peru | 99.4% | 2023 | up 0.1% | flat |
| 7 | Chile | 99.3% | 2022 | down 0.3% | flat |
| 7 | Ecuador | 99.3% | 2023 | down 0.1% | flat |
| 9 | El Salvador | 99.1% | 2023 | up 1.0% | flat |
| 10 | Bolivia, Plurinational State of | 98.9% | 2021 | down 0.2% | flat |
| 10 | Honduras | 98.9% | 2023 | down 0.3% | flat |
| 10 | Mexico | 98.9% | 2022 | down 0.7% | flat |
| 13 | Dominican Republic | 98.6% | 2023 | up 0.1% | flat |
| 14 | Costa Rica | 98.5% | 2024 | down 1.3% | flat |
| 15 | Guatemala | 98.4% | 2023 | up 0.9% | rising |
| 16 | Colombia | 97.6% | 2023 | down 0.6% | flat |
| 17 | Lesotho | 95.7% | 2023 | down 1.8% | rising |
| 18 | Nepal | 95.5% | 2022 | up 1.5% | flat |
| 19 | Congo, Democratic Republic of the | 90.3% | 2024 | down 1.6% | rising |
| 20 | Cameroon | 89.1% | 2018 | up 1.4% | flat |
| 21 | Zambia | 88.1% | 2023 | up 2.6% | rising |
| 22 | Nigeria | 86.8% | 2021 | down 2.9% | rising |
| 23 | Bangladesh | 86.7% | 2022 | down 6.3% | rising |
| 24 | Gambia | 86.1% | 2020 | up 16.2% | rising |
| 25 | Benin | 84.6% | 2021 | up 2.7% | rising |
| 26 | Senegal | 75.1% | 2023 | up 9.0% | rising |
| 27 | Mali | 65.5% | 2024 | up 16.7% | rising |
